Stale Array Please help

Featured Replies

Hey all

 

I have restarted my unraid box after joining to domain and now its come up stale configuration.  

 

I have a backup of the usb stick should i just be able to restore and it should work.  Please help all my data is on there and i havent setup backups yet :( was planned for tomorrow DOH!

 

Thanks

 

Mat

  • Author

I tried the restore of backup and same issue.  All disk are there can i add them back in the same order and will the data stay?

 

  • Community Expert
54 minutes ago, Mat1987 said:

All disk are there can i add them back in the same order and will the data stay?

Yes, make sure no data drive is assigned to a parity slot, and you can check "parity is already valid" if using all the previous assignments.
